WCAG - Event Calendar Enhancements
- Evan Stewart
- Version 9.6.2.0
Enhanced Keyboard Navigation: We've optimized keyboard navigation throughout the portal, making it easier for users who rely on keyboard inputs or screen readers to access and interact with all features seamlessly. The tab order is shown in the image.
Color and Contrast Improvements: We've enhanced color choices and contrast ratios for the calendar title, dates, and days to make content more readable, ensuring that information is easily discernible for users with vision impairments.
ARIA Roles and Attributes:
We've incorporated ARIA (Accessible Rich Internet Applications) roles and attributes to the following items
1,2... 7 : Buttons
8, 9... 26: Links
12, 13... 15: Button
We've added ARIA (Accessible Rich Internet Applications) labels where necessary
7: Added 'aria-label'
Clearer Text and Layout: We've increased the contrast and font sizes of the calendar title, and dates to ensure the content is clearly visible, and conveys the correct interactive state to the user.